Antique Persian Bijar Heriz Serapi Hand Knotted Rug, Made in the area of Gholtugh Bijar, Kurdistan, in Iran (Old Persia) at around 1920, from 100% wool and vegetable dyes in the geometric pattern and colors common of the Heriz region. It is called a Serapi rug, because this is the name given to the better quality Seriz rugs. It measures 203cm X 115cm (81" X 46").
